G?O 1 913 343 1 34/05 SANITARY CONTROL EASEMENT DATE: ~ g GRANTOR: GRANTOR'S ADDRESS: GRANTEE: GRANTEE'S ADDRESS: SANITARY CONTROL EASEMENT: Purpose, Restriction, and Uses of Easement: 1. The purpose of this easement is to protect the water supply of the well described and located below by means of sanitary control. 2. The construction and operation of underground petroleum and chemical storage tanks and liquid transmission pipelines, stock pens, feedlots, dump grounds, privies, cesspools, septic tank or sewage treatment drainfields, improperly constructed water wells of any depth and all other construction or operation that could create an insanitary condition within, upon, or across the property subject to this easement are prohibited wthin this easement. For the purpose of the easement, improperly constructed water wells are those wells which do not meet the surtace and subsurtace construction standards for a public water supply well. 3. The construction of the or concrete sanitary sewers, sewer appurtenances, septic tanks, storm sewers, and cemeteries is specifically prohibited within a 50-foot radius of the water well described and located below. 4. This easement permits the construction of homes or buildings upon the Grantor's property as long as all items in Restrictions Nos. 2 and 3 are recognized and followed. 5. This easement permits normal farming and ranching operations, except that livestock shall not be allowed within SO feet of the water well. The Grantor's property subject to this Easement is described in the documents recorded at: Volume ,Pages of the Real Property Records of Texan ---County, Property Subject to Alt of that area within a 150-foot radius of the water well located feet at a radial of degrees from the corner of Lot of a Subdivision of Record in Book Page of the County Plat Records, County, Texas. TERM: This easement shall run with the land and shall be binding on all parties and persons claiming under the Grantor for a period of two years from the date that this easement is recorded; after which time, this easement shall be automatically extended until the use of the subject water well as a source of water for public systems ceases. ENFORCEMENT: Enforcement of this easement shall be proceedings at law or in equity against any person or persons violating or attempting to violate this restriction in this easement, either to restrain the violation or to recover damages. INVALIDATION: Invalidation of any one of these restrictions or uses (covenants) by a judgement or court order shall not affect any of the other provisions of this easement which shall remain in full force and effect. TEXAS NATURAL RESOURCE CONSERVATION COM Chapter 290. WATER HYGIENE MISSION Subchapter D. RULES AND REGULATIONS FOR PUBLIC WAT SYSTEMS ER _§ 290.41 Water Sources t Y• .. (a) Water quality. The quality of water to be supplied must meet the quality criteria prescribed commission's drinking water standards. by the (b) Water quantity. Sources of supply, both ground and surface, shalt have a safe yield ca abl supplying the maximum daily demands of the distribution system during extended periods of eak usage and critical hydrologic conditions. The pipe lines and pumping capacities to treatment plants or distribution systems shall be adequate for such water delivery. Minimum capacities required are specified in § 290.45 of this title (relating to Minimum Water System Capacity Requirements . (c) Ground water sources and development. ) (1) Ground water sources shall be located so that there will be no danger of pollution from floodi or from insanitary surroundings, such as privies, sewage, sewage treatment plants, livestock and ng aroma] pens, sofid waste disposal sites or underground petroleum and chemical storage tanks and tiqurd transmission pipelines, or abandoned and improperly sealed wells. (A) No well site which is within 50 feet of a the or concrete sanitary sewer, sewers e a u septic tank, storm sewer, or cemetery; or which is within 1 SO feet of a septic tank perfora rtdenance, drainfield, areas irrigated by low dosage, low angle spray on-site sewage facilities, absorption bed evapotranspiration bed, improperly constructed water well or underground petroleum and chemical storage tank or liquid transmission pipeline will be acceptable for use as a public drinking water supply. Sanitary or storm sewers constructed of ductile iron or PVC pipe meeting AWWA standards, having a minimum working pressure of 1 SO si or be located at distances of less than SO feet from a p oposed well site bus in no case shall the ditnts may be Less than ten feet. stance (B) No well site shall be located within S00 feet of a sewage treatment plant or within 300 feet of a sewage wet well, sewage pumping station, or a drainage ditch which contains industrial waste discharges or the wastes from sewage treatment systems. (C) No water wells shall be located within S00 feet of animal feed lots, solid waste disposal sites, lands on which sewage plant or septic tank sludge is applied, or lands irrigated by sewage piarn effluent. (D) Livestock in pastures shall not be allowed within SO feet of water supply wells. (E) A11 known abandoned or inoperative wells (unused wells that have not been plu ed quarter mile of a proposed wellsite shall be reported to the Commission along with existing or ~n °ne 30 TAC 290.41 \) Page 2 of 7 potential pollution hazards. These reports are required for community and nontransient, noncommunity ground water sources. Examples of existing or potential pollution hazards which may affect ground water quality include, but are not limited to: landfill and dump sites, animal feedlots, military facilities, industrial facilities, wood-treatment facilities, liquid petroleum and petrochemical production, storage, and transmission facilities, Class 1, 2, 3, and 4 injection wells, and pesticide storage and mixing facilities. This information must be submitted prior to construction or as required by the executive director. (F) A sanitary control easement covering that portion of the land within I 50 feet of the well location shad be secured from all such property owners and recorded in the deed records at the county courthouse. The easement shall provide that none of the pollution hazards covered in subparagraphs (A)-(E) ofthis paragraph, or any facilities that might create a danger ofpoilution to the water to be produced from the well will be located thereon. For the purpose ofthis easement, an improperly constructed water well is one which fails to meet the surface and subsurface construction standards for public water supply wells. Residential type wells within the easement must be constructed to public water well standards. Copies of the recorded easements shalt be included with plans and specifications submitted for review. (2) The premises, materials, tools, and drilling equipment shall be maintained so as to minimize contamination of the underground water during drilling operation. (A) Water used in any drilling operation shall be of safe sanita drilling fluids or mud shall contain a chlorine residual of at least 0.5 m~ Water used in the mixing of (B) The slush pit shall be constructed and maintained so as to minimize contamination of the drilling mud. (C) No temporary toilet facilities shall be maintained within 150 feet of the well being constructed unless they are of a sealed, leakproof type. (3) Special attention must be given to the construction, disinfection, protection, and testing of a well to be used as a public water supply source. (A) Before placing the well into service, the Commission's Water Utilities Division shall be furnished a copy of the well completion data, which includes the following items: the Driller's Log (geological log and material setting report); a cementing certificate; the results of a 36-hour pump test; the results of the microbiological and chemical analyses required by subparagraphs ~F and ~ of this paragraph; a copy of the Sanitary Control Easement; and an original or legible copy of a United States Geological Survey 7.5-minute topographic quadrangle showing the accurate well location. All the documents fisted in this paragraph must be approved by the executive director before final approval is-- granted for the use of the well. (B) The casing material used in the construction of wells for public use shall be new carbon steel, high-strength low-alloy steel, stainless steel, or plastic. The material shall conform to AWWA standards. The casing shall extend a minimum of 18 inches above the elevation of the finished floor of the pump room or natural ground surface and a minimum of one inch above the sealing block or pump motor foundation block when provided. The casing shall extend at least to the depth of the shallowest water formation to be developed and deeper, if necessary, in order to eliminate all undesirable water-bearing strata.
